Year Inducted: 2012
Mark ran for 4,078 yards during his career at Delone, becoming the all-time leading rusher in school history. He gained 6,438 total yards and scored 64 touchdowns over three varsity seasons. As a senior, Mark was named to the Associated Press small school All-State team. Mark was also a member of the Squires’ 1989 State Championship basketball team. Mark went on to play football at Lehigh University where, as a sophomore, he led the Patriot League in punt return yardage, and as a junior he led the league and was fourth in Division I-AA in scoring. He was named pre-season league MVP prior to his senior year, but a knee injury forced him to take a medical redshirt. A year later, he helped lead Lehigh to its first Patriot League Championship.
